WebSuppose we want to find P ( X ≤ 2). We can use Minitab to find this cumulative probability. From the Minitab menu select Calc > Probability Distributions > Binomial. Enter in 3 and 0.2 as above. Choose Cumulative Probability . Choose Input Constant and enter 2. Choose OK . The result should be P ( X ≤ 2) = 0.992 . Note! WebR has four in-built functions to generate binomial distribution. They are described below. dbinom (x, size, prob) pbinom (x, size, prob) qbinom (p, size, prob) rbinom (n, size, prob) Following is the description of the parameters used −. x is a vector of numbers. p is a vector of probabilities. n is number of observations.
